Output 0623580077663a528ed5e7849dcf1c8a76b23e13157bad9b492a789038c22ec1:14

value
37961908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7932b6691843d017975ef5f0ebb8eeb1d3c372f2 OP_EQUAL
address
3CjrSKmQwRQbxPQaT3Srx4civ4pHFqFsYn
transaction
0623580077663a528ed5e7849dcf1c8a76b23e13157bad9b492a789038c22ec1
spent
true